Abstract

These experiments tested the effects of subcutaneous (SC) and paraventricular nucleus (PVN) administration of the steroid receptor agonists, corticosterone (CORT), aldosterone (ALDO), RU28362, and dexamethasone (DEX), on food intake and macronutrient selection during the first h of the dark feeding period in the rat. Results indicate that CORT and the selective type II receptor agonist RU28362 specifically stimulate carbohydrate ingestion after SC or PVN administration, while DEX has no effect on feeding. This selective effect of SC CORT on carbohydrate ingestion is dose dependent, seen at doses ranging from 0.125 to 2.0 mg/kg. Moreover, the stimulatory effects of CORT and RU28362 on carbohydrate intake are observed in ADX rats but not in sham rats. This is in contrast to SC and PVN administration of the type I receptor agonist ALDO, which specifically enhances fat ingestion in both sham and ADX rats. These results, with both peripheral and central steroid administration, reveal selective effects of type I and type II receptor stimulation on fat and carbohydrate intake, respectively.
